Jim Kelly said his Bills had a chance in LA this past Sunday. I guess we didn't relize what he was talking about. Kelly, completed 31 of 40 passes for 357 yards and 4 TDs as his Bills destoyed the Raiders 31-10 at the L.A. Collisum. Andre Reed caught 12 balls for 161 yards and 2 of the Kelly strikes. The Bills also contained Raiders RB Marcus Allen who just had 90 yards on 20 carries.
The Raiders drew first blood as Jim Plunkett hit Don Hasselbeck in the end zone to give the Raiders a 7-0 lead. After a Norwood FG, the Bills came back with Kelly's first touchdown pass, this one to James Lofton. The Bills ended the quarter with Andre Reed's first TD grab. 17-7, Buffalo. They led 17-10 at the break. They scored twice in the 3rd quarter. And won the game 31-10.
The Bills won despite just 18 yards of rushing from Thurman Thomas. Jim Kelly got the Player of the Game honor. |
